Case is made of blue cloth covered boards. Lid opens to reveal over fifty dominoes. Gilt label on lid reads, “SOCIAL PASTIME”. Clasp is missing the part it is meant to hook to. Dominoes are made of a wooden base with bone tacked to the top. Dots are colored in black or red.
Case measures 3 ¾” by 8 ¼”. Shows light wear, mostly on corners and edges. Each domino measures 1½” by ¾”. [sl]
